The Basics of Windscreen Functionality
A windscreen serves multiple purposes: it secures passengers from wind and particles, contributes to the structural stability of the lorry, and aids in the correct performance of airbags. When set up correctly, a windshield boosts visibility while keeping security standards. However, even minor modifications in temperature can affect its efficiency over time.
Windscreens are typically made from laminated glass-- 2 sheets of glass with a layer of polyvinyl butyral (PVB) sandwiched between them. This style supplies strength against shattering and assists to keep everyone inside safe throughout a mishap. Nevertheless, this building and construction also means that the glass is sensitive to thermal stress triggered by considerable temperature changes.
The Science Behind Temperature Fluctuations
Temperature fluctuations can be severe depending upon where you live. Regions that experience hot summer seasons and cold winters see substantial swings in temperature level, which can worry a windscreen. This tension takes place since various parts of the glass broaden or contract at various https://cesarnsuq469.trexgame.net/how-to-pick-the-very-best-windscreen-repair-in-san-diego rates when exposed to differing temperatures.
For example, if a cars and truck sits outdoors on a scorching summer day with temperature levels reaching upwards of 90 degrees Fahrenheit (32 degrees Celsius), then unexpectedly drives into an air-conditioned garage where temperature levels drop to around 70 degrees Fahrenheit (21 degrees Celsius), this fast modification produces thermal shock. Over time, repeated instances like this can cause micro-cracking within the laminated layers, eventually compromising the integrity of your windscreen.
Factors Affecting Temperature Impact
Several factors affect how temperature level changes impact your brand-new windshield's durability:
Geographic Location: Locations with high seasonal irregularity will cause more rapid expansions and contractions than regions with moderate climates.
Installation Quality: A badly set up windscreen might not handle temperature level modifications well due to inadequate bonding materials or misalignment.
Driving Habits: Regular use of defrosters or air conditioning can produce hot spots on your windshield if not uniformly distributed.
Glass Quality: Higher-quality glass normally stands up to temperature level stress better than cheaper alternatives.
Environmental Conditions: Extended direct exposure to direct sunlight or extreme cold can intensify wear and tear on your windshield.

Maintenance Tips for Longevity
Taking proactive steps can considerably boost the life time of your new windshield under fluctuating temperature levels:
- Regular Inspections: Look for chips or cracks routinely; even little damage can get worse due to thermal expansion. Proper Cleaning up Techniques: Usage appropriate cleaning services developed for automobile glass instead of home cleaners that might contain ammonia. Avoid Extreme Temperature level Changes: If possible, park in a garage throughout severe climate condition rather than exposing your vehicle straight to hot sun or freezing conditions. Use UV Protection Films: These movies can help reduce heat build-up inside your automobile while offering extra defense from UV rays that deteriorate both your interior and exterior surfaces. Invest in Quality Repairs: If chips do take place, have them repaired quickly by specialists who understand how temperature level impacts laminated glass.
